Allegro Brillante

Allegro Brillante is a term used in classical music, particularly in the context of ballet and orchestral compositions. It denotes a lively and spirited tempo, suggesting a sense of brightness and joyous energy. It is often associated with fast-paced piece that showcases technical skill and exuberance. The term is famously linked to the ballet "Allegro Brillante" choreographed by George Balanchine, which features intricate, fast movements set to Peter Ilyich Tchaikovsky's music. The piece is known for its vibrant rhythms and dynamic patterns, emphasizing both the dancers' agility and the music's celebratory character.
